We seek to contribute to the debate over globalization and the environment by asking: What is the effect of trade on a country's environment, for a given level of GDP? We take specific account of the endogeneity of trade, using exogenous geographic determinants of trade as instrumental variables. We find that trade tends to reduce three measures of air pollution. Statistical significance is high for concentrations of SO2, moderate for NO2, and lacking for particulate matter. Although results for other environmental measures are not as encouraging, there is little evidence that trade has a detrimental effect on the environment.
Until recently, there was an unusual degree of consensus among economists that intervention by central banks in the foreign-exchange market did not offer an effective or lasting instrument for affecting the exchange rate, at least not independently of monetary policy. This consensus was largely shared among policymakers and participants in the financial markets as well. The 1982 G-7 economic summit at Versailles commissioned a study of intervention, known as the Jurgenson report, which found that the effects were small and transitory at most.' We think that the time is ripe for new statistical testing of the question. Many policymakers and foreign-exchange traders believe that the intervention operations that have taken place since the Plaza Agreement of September 1985 have had an effect, especially when operations are coordinated. Moreover, the theoretical case against the effectiveness of intervention is not as clear as a reading of the economics literature might suggest. The academic literature is predicated on the distinction between intervention operations that are sterilized and those that are allowed to affect the money supply. We study the intervention operations that actually took place between 1982 and 1988, regardless of whether they were sterilized. However, we do begin in Section I with a review of the issues involved.2 There are two possible channels through which intervention (whether sterilized or not) can influence the foreign-exchange rate: the portfolio and the expectations channels. Intervention can, even if sterilized, influence exchange rates through the portfolio channel, provided foreign and domestic bonds are considered imperfect substitutes in investors' portfolios. Intervention operations that, for example, increase the current relative supply of mark to dollar assets which private investors are obliged to accept into their portfolios, will force a decrease in the relative price of mark assets.3 Intervention can also influence exchange rates, regardless of whether foreign and domestic bonds are imperfect substitutes, through the expectations channel. The public information that central banks are intervening in support of a currency (or are planning to intervene in the future) may, under certain conditions, cause speculators to expect an increase in the price of that currency in the future. Speculators react to this information by buying the currency today, bringing about the change in the exchange rate today. In their paper in this Review, Jeffrey A. Frankel and Katherine E. Rockett (1988) show that when international macroeconomic policymakers do not agree on the correct macroeconomic model, they will still be able to agree on a cooperative policy package that each believes will improve his welfare. Yet the package may turn out to move target variables in the wrong direction. From extensive simulation experiments with ten empirical models, Frankel and Rockett conclude: ...the bargaining solution is as likely to reduce welfare as to improve it. But more definitions of cooperation should be investigated... (p. 338). In this paper we propose an alternative definition of a policy bargain to that investigated by Frankel and Rockett and show that results in a higher success rate and higher expected utility in cooperation exper-iments. It follows from our finding that, given uncertainty or ignorance about the true model, a measure of disagreement is beneficial because facilitates a simple robustness check for proposed policy bargains. As Frankel and Rockett (1988 p. 328) acknowledge: it is the countries' failure to perceive the true model, not their failure to agree with each other per se, that alters the standard conclusion regarding coordination (i.e., is uncertainty, not disagreement, that leads to failure). We go further: given the inevitable failure to perceive the true model, some disagreement is better than unanimity in error. Extreme disagreement about the nature of reality, however, makes robust bargains impossible.
